Why OBENA, and how it works
Why
We are growing apart — polarization, echo chambers, loneliness — and disunity sits at the root of our gravest risks, from democratic breakdown to war.
How
OBENA turns hard public issues into things people can actually reason through — and into conversations that build real connection and shared goals.
What changes
A world with more togetherness: sturdier democracies, and people living more connected, fulfilled lives.
The age of AI is another chance to get this right.

Our team
Our core team formed in 2024 as an interdisciplinary collaboration in New York City. We’re a small but growing group from very different worlds — engineering, markets, journalism, marketing — united by a shared belief in the mission: that technology can bring people together rather than drive them apart, and that few things matter more right now than building it that way.
In addition to those named below, we’re deeply grateful to the many professionals around the world — from Big Tech to academia — who have contributed their time, skills, and guidance. Their generosity has shaped our progress every step of the way.

Mike Albrecht
Mike grew up in a small town, happiest when he was coding or lost in a computer game. College opened up a much bigger world, and he became fascinated with how it all works — a path that led through applied mathematics at Carnegie Mellon to Wall Street, first as a quant and then as a global macro strategist.
He spent over a decade in that role, distilling complex economic and geopolitical issues into clear, balanced viewpoints for every kind of audience — and watching, from that vantage point, as the technology he grew up loving helped drive people apart. He came to believe the problem wasn’t technology itself but the incentives behind it, and that someone should prove it could be built differently.
In late 2024 he took the leap: he left his career, retooled in AI and modern software engineering, and now builds OBENA full time.
Outside work he powerlifts, cycles, hikes, and takes photographs.

Brionna Jimerson
Brionna Jimerson is a product marketing executive with over a decade of experience using technology to enhance the human experience and bridge the gaps that separate us. Most recently her product marketing has centered on AI applications; previously she led consumer product marketing in Big Tech, the financial sector, and telecommunications, after beginning her career in journalism at NPR and PBS. Brionna’s life work lies at the intersection of storytelling and public service.
With OBENA, she lends her editorial voice and her curiosity to the team as she builds a future worth fighting for, one where connection resonates louder than confusion.
